# @TEST-PORT: BROKER_PORT
# @TEST-EXEC: btest-bg-run zeek zeek -j -b %INPUT
# @TEST-EXEC: btest-bg-wait 20
# @TEST-EXEC: btest-diff zeek/supervisor.out
# @TEST-EXEC: btest-diff zeek/node.out
# So the supervised node doesn't terminate right away.
redef exit_only_after_terminate=T;
global supervisor_output_file: file;
global node_output_file: file;
global topic = "test-topic";
global peers_added = 0;
event kill_self()
{
system(fmt("kill %s", getpid()));
}
event zeek_init()
{
if ( Supervisor::is_supervisor() )
{
Broker::subscribe(topic);
Broker::listen("127.0.0.1", to_port(getenv("BROKER_PORT")));
supervisor_output_file = open("supervisor.out");
print supervisor_output_file, "supervisor zeek_init()";
local sn = Supervisor::NodeConfig($name="grault");
local res = Supervisor::create(sn);
if ( res != "" )
print supervisor_output_file, res;
}
else
{
Broker::subscribe(topic);
Broker::peer("127.0.0.1", to_port(getenv("BROKER_PORT")));
node_output_file = open("node.out");
print node_output_file, "supervised node zeek_init()";
}
}
event Broker::peer_added(endpoint: Broker::EndpointInfo, msg: string)
{
++peers_added;
if ( Supervisor::is_supervisor() )
{
print supervisor_output_file, "supervisor connected to peer";
if ( peers_added == 3 )
terminate();
else
Broker::publish(topic, kill_self);
}
}
event Broker::peer_lost(endpoint: Broker::EndpointInfo, msg: string)
{
if ( Supervisor::is_supervisor() )
print supervisor_output_file, "supervisor lost peer";
}
event zeek_done()
{
if ( Supervisor::is_supervisor() )
print supervisor_output_file, "supervisor zeek_done()";
else
print node_output_file, "supervised node zeek_done()";
}
